The problems existing in the dietary structure of China are as follows.
At present, the dietary structure in China has the following problems:
① In the dietary structure of urban residents, the consumption of livestock meat and fat is too high, the proportion of fat energy supply exceeds 30%, the proportion of animal fat is high, and the consumption of cereal food is low.
② The dietary structure of rural residents tends to be reasonable, but the consumption of animal food, vegetables and fruits is still low.
③ Insufficient intake of dairy products and legumes exists in both urban and rural areas of China.
④ The deficiency of micronutrients such as iron, calcium and vitamin A is a common problem in urban and rural areas.
⑤ Salt intake is generally high.
